About CXM, Research & Insights Team

CXM, Research & Insights team is a part of Central Retail Corporation and oversees the Total Experience Ecosystem across CRC and Central Group. This ecosystem comprises of Customer Experience (CX), Employee Experience (EX), Brand Experience (BX), and Research & Insightsforming a unified experience management framework that connects employees, customers, brands, and data-driven insights to elevate the overall experience.

Our mission is to drive and deliver relevant product and service offerings for each customer segment and a best-in-class omni-channel customer experience for all Business Units under CRC and Central Group (e.g., Central Department Store, Robinson, Tops, Power Buy, Thai Watsadu, Central Pattana, etc.). We operate with deep customer-centric philosophy grounded in empathy, leveraging advanced technologies to capture, analyze, and transform customer feedback into impactful, actionable solutions. These insights are strategically gathered from every critical touchpoint along the customer journey.

Roles & Responsibilities

Research Program Management Responsibilities (30%)

  • Oversee quantitative and qualitative research programs
  • Manage end-to-end research design and implementation in accordance with CRC business requirements and/or strategic needs including: scoping, sampling, questionnaire design, fieldwork, analysis, and reporting.
  • Track the progress of each project and set precise deadlines for specific/critical tasks.
  • Manage the timeline and execution plans of the research projects
  • Identify potential risks, issues, and help implement corrective actions to keep projects on track and within budget.
  • Lead both in-house research and vendor-managed studies; ensure methodological rigor and high quality.

Data Analysis & Insight Delivery (20%)

  • Synthesize complex customer, market, and business data into clear, actionable insights.
  • Translate insights into strategic recommendations for CRC business units.
  • Present findings through compelling executive reports and precise storytelling.

Governance, Budget & Performance (20%)

  • Oversee research budget, cost optimization, and vendor performance management (for outsource research projects)
  • Ensure data quality, governance, compliance, and methodological accuracy.
  • Evaluate impact of insights on business outcomes and organizational priorities.

Cross-functional Collaboration (20%)

  • Partner with various functional teams of CRC Business Units to embed insights into decision-making.
  • Influence stakeholders at all levels to act on insights and drive customer-centric improvements.
  • Manage relationships with external agencies and research partners.

Team Leadership & Development (10%)

  • Lead and develop a high-performing Research & Insights team with diverse expertise.
  • Implement best practices, research standards, and continuous improvement processes.
  • Foster a culture of curiosity, analytical thinking, and evidence-based decision making.

Qualifications

Education:

Bachelor's or Master's degree in Business, Statistics, Marketing, Psychology, Economics, or related field.

Experience:

  • At least 7 years in research, insights, customer analytics, or strategypreferably in a complex or multi-BU organization.
  • Strong proficiency in both quantitative and qualitative research methodologies.
  • Proven track record of delivering insights that influence senior leadership and business outcomes.
  • Experience managing agencies, budgets, and cross-functional initiatives.

Technical & Analytical Skills:

  • Strong knowledge of quantitative survey, and qualitative customer study design, sampling, statistics, and insight frameworks.
  • Proficiency with analytics tools (e.g., Qualtrics, SPSS, Python, Power BI, Tableau, etc.).
  • Strong presentation, storytelling, and insight communication skills.
  • Strong cabability to conduct in-depth interviews and effectively moderate focus groups.

Leadership & Soft Skills:

  • Strategic thinker with strong business acumen.
  • Excellent stakeholder management and influencing skills.
  • Strong team leadership, coaching, and organizational sk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ects in a fast-paced environment.
